Physical Access Control System Design Services Requested for Altoona VA Medical Center, Pennsylvania

WASHINGTON, June 6 -- The Department of Veterans Affairs is seeking an Engineering Services Firm to provide design services for the replacement of the Physical Access Control System at the Altoona VA Medical Center in Altoona, Pennsylvania. This project, valued at approximately $4 million, aims to enhance security measures at the facility, ensuring a safer environment for both patients and staff.
